China - Sweet Potatoes Yield
Since 2014, China Sweet Potatoes Yield rose 0.7%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 18 among other countries in Sweet Potatoes Yield at 219,031 Hectograms Per Hectare. China is overtaken by Italy, which was number 17 at 220,051 Hectograms Per Hectare and is followed by Japan with 218,280 Hectograms Per Hectare. Senegal ranked the highest with 385,997 Hectograms Per Hectare in 2019, an increase of 2.3% versus 2018. Australia, Ethiopia and Réunion resp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Sierra Leone recorded the best 5 years average growth at +16% per year, while Chad recorded the worst performance at -15.3% per year.
Date | Hectograms Per Hectare |
---|---|
2019 | 219,031.00 |
2018 | 223,785.00 |
2017 | 222,463.00 |
2016 | 210,792.00 |
2015 | 215,229.00 |
